Output e125c004f4e6efb4dbfbc78c6405fd1b31fe2bcbad20ffa0d032e7221ba53409:9

value
149639
script pubkey
OP_0 OP_PUSHBYTES_20 e97534f7024ea7c6c119198543bf04c97237f167
address
bc1qa96nfaczf6nudsgerxz580cye9er0ut8y3kmug
transaction
e125c004f4e6efb4dbfbc78c6405fd1b31fe2bcbad20ffa0d032e7221ba53409
confirmations
147160
spent
true